Creating a Live Dealer Casino in 2026: Key Insights

The live dealer segment of the online casino industry is poised for remarkable growth in the coming years, driven by operators eager to capitalize on the popularity of immersive gaming experiences. To explore how to establish a successful live dealer casino in 2026, we refer to a recent publication from Periódico Digital Centroamericano y del Caribe, which outlines critical considerations for launching a live dealer platform.

With advancements in streaming technology and the increasing demand for real-time interaction, operators must stay abreast of industry trends. The landscape of live dealer gaming is continuously evolving. For example, the integration of high-definition video feeds and interactive features are transforming how players engage with live dealer tables.

A spokesperson for Periódico Digital Centroamericano y del Caribe highlighted this shift in a statement on October 5, 2023: "The live dealer experience is not just about the games; it's about creating an engaging and dynamic environment for players to connect with dealers and each other."

Counter-take: Market growth vs. Challenges

While the anticipated 10% CAGR by 2026 sounds encouraging, it is crucial to recognize the challenges that this growth may present. The live dealer market is not solely about entering a lucrative segment; it also involves navigating stringent regulations and fierce competition. Many operators face significant hurdles, including high operational costs and the need for constant technological upgrades. A hefty fine of £273,000 can be daunting, but this often pales in comparison to the investments required to maintain a competitive live dealer studio.
